#eb7ec5 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#eb7ec5 is composed of 92.2% red, 49.4% green and 77.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 46.4% magenta, 16.2% yellow and 7.8% black. It has a hue angle of 320.9 degrees, a saturation of 73.2% and a lightness of 70.8%. #eb7ec5 color hex could be obtained by blending #fffcff with #d7008b. Closest websafe color is: #ff66cc.

● #eb7ec5 color description : Soft pink.
The hexadecimal color #eb7ec5 has RGB values of R:235, G:126, B:197 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.46, Y:0.16, K:0.08. Its decimal value is 15433413.
